<strong>Stiller</strong> <strong>Collection</strong><br />
5 Linear feet<br />
Major <strong>Stiller</strong> was an Aide-de-Camp to GEN <strong>Patton</strong> during World War II. Their<br />
friendship went back further to World War I, but little is actually known about <strong>Stiller</strong>.<br />
This is a collection <strong>of</strong> materials sent by his daughter to the museum. <strong>Collection</strong> <strong>of</strong><br />
documents, manuals, <strong>and</strong> other materials collected by LTC Alex<strong>and</strong>er <strong>Stiller</strong> during his<br />
active <strong>and</strong> reserve duty, 1941 – 1960. Accession 2002-119-01<br />
